The City of Greensboro is seeking a Crew Leader to lead a small field crew responsible for asphalt installation, pavement repairs, utility cuts, and pothole repairs on public streets and City property. This is an opportunity to combine your construction expertise, leadership skills, equipment knowledge, and commitment to public service while building a career with the City of Greensboro. Every day, residents rely on Greensboro's streets to safely get to work, school, appointments, businesses, and home. As a Crew Leader, you'll lead a two-person field crew responsible for repairing potholes, pavement failures, and utility cuts while helping maintain the City's transportation infrastructure. This is a working supervisor position. You'll spend your time in the field alongside your crew while also planning, organizing, coordinating, and reporting on assigned projects. The Crew Leader is a working supervisor responsible for leading a small crew of approximately two employees in construction and maintenance activities. You will report to a Section Supervisor and be responsible for planning, organizing, coordinating, and reporting assigned work in support of the overall Field Operations work plan.
